The idea for this book came from the author's experiences with her
own children who, like many students, struggled with putting what
they wanted to say into words, especially when the 'saying'
involved writing. It has been Patricia's experience that students
need help to develop the language that mature writers use. In this
book, there are sentence starters and connectives that students
should use when demonstrating a particular writing skill. Language
is the way that it is because of the job that it does, and letting
students into the secret of this makes a significant difference to
the quality of work they produce.
